Polyamide, also known as PA, is a thermoplastic polycondensate. Common trade names are Ultramid and Zytel. nylon (PA 6) It has high lubricity and moderate strength. It is tough, inexpensive, but has poor dimensional stability due to water absorption (hygroscopic nature). PA is commonly used to make high-lubricity parts such as bearings, blow moldings molds, and clothing fabrics.
